Meeting your chauffeur at EuroAirport Swiss

Arrival from Basel Airport BSL to Basel City by Luxury Vehicle - Meeting your chauffeur at EuroAirport Swiss

The most important part of this transfer happens before you even reach the car. After collecting your luggage, follow signs toward the Swiss exit, not the French or German exit. EuroAirport is unusual because the same airport serves three countries, and the wrong exit can put you in the wrong arrival area.

Your chauffeur waits in the arrivals hall with a sign showing the lead passenger’s name. That is a practical touch after a flight, especially if you are dealing with children, several bags, or a busy arrival hall. You do not need to search through a general taxi queue or wonder if a shared van has already left.

The service includes up to 60 minutes of waiting time after your flight arrives and your luggage is collected. Incoming flights are monitored, so a delay should not automatically leave you stranded. Still, provide your flight number, airline, and a mobile number that works abroad when you book. If you cannot find the chauffeur, use the phone number on your confirmation or contact the emergency number supplied with it.

The pickup arrangement is clear, but it rewards careful planning. Save the operator’s number before boarding, keep your phone charged, and remember that the meeting point is the Swiss arrivals hall. Those three steps prevent most avoidable confusion.

Choosing between the Mercedes V Class and S Class

The vehicle depends on your party size. A Mercedes Benz V Class or similar luxury minivan carries up to six passengers. A Mercedes Benz S Class or similar luxury sedan is intended for up to two passengers.

For a couple with light luggage, the sedan gives you a polished private ride without sharing space with anyone else. For a family or small group, the V Class is the more sensible choice. One group of four adults and one child found it easy to manage a large quantity of luggage, and another family of four had room for eight bags in the minivan.

That example also shows why you should be exact about luggage. The stated allowance is one suitcase and one carry-on per person. Surfboards, golf clubs, bicycles, and other bulky items may not fit, or may require an extra charge. Contact RHOMTRIP before departure if your bags exceed the standard allowance.

The vehicle provides bottled water, and the booking includes airport taxes, handling charges, and 60 minutes of parking. Food and other drinks are not included. Excess luggage charges, if applicable, are also outside the basic price.

FAQ

Where does the Basel airport transfer begin?

It begins at EuroAirport Swiss in Basel, Switzerland. After collecting your luggage, meet the chauffeur in the Swiss arrivals hall.

Which airport exit should I use?

Use the Swiss exit. EuroAirport also has exits for France and Germany, and leaving through the wrong side can cause delays when meeting your chauffeur.

How long will the chauffeur wait?

The transfer includes 60 minutes of waiting time after your arrival. Incoming flights are monitored, so the operator can account for flight delays.

How many people can ride in the private vehicle?

The maximum is six people per booking. A Mercedes Benz V Class or similar minivan is available for up to six passengers, while a Mercedes Benz S Class or similar sedan is intended for up to two.

How much luggage can each person bring?

Each person may bring one suitcase and one carry-on bag. Oversized items such as surfboards, golf clubs, or bicycles may have restrictions, so contact the operator before booking.

Can I cancel for a full refund?

Yes, if you cancel at least 24 hours before the experience start time. Cancellations or changes made less than 24 hours before the start time are not accepted for a refund.
